What Is Laparoscopy Insufflator Repair Service In Gabon?

Laparoscopy insufflator repair service in Gabon refers to the specialized maintenance and restoration of insufflator devices used in laparoscopic surgical procedures. These medical devices are critical for establishing a pneumoperitoneum, which creates a working space within the abdominal or thoracic cavity by inflating it with gas, typically carbon dioxide. The service ensures these machines function optimally, maintaining precise gas flow rates, pressure, and volume to guarantee surgical safety and efficacy. This includes troubleshooting, component replacement, calibration, and full system diagnostics. The service is crucial for healthcare facilities in Gabon performing minimally invasive surgeries. Key use cases include ensuring the continuous operation of insufflators during laparoscopic cholecystectomy, appendectomy, hysterectomy, colectomy, and various diagnostic laparoscopies, all of which are prevalent procedures where insufflation is a fundamental requirement.

Key Aspects of Laparoscopy Insufflator Repair Service in Gabon

  • Diagnostic Assessment: Thorough evaluation of the insufflator's operational status and identification of faults.
  • Component Replacement: Sourcing and installing genuine or compatible parts for damaged or worn components (e.g., valves, regulators, tubing, electronic boards).
  • Calibration and Testing: Re-calibrating the device to manufacturer specifications for accurate pressure, flow rate, and volume delivery, followed by rigorous functional testing.
  • Preventive Maintenance: Scheduled servicing to identify and address potential issues before they lead to failure.
  • Safety Checks: Verification of all safety features and alarms to ensure compliance with medical device standards.
  • Technical Support: Provision of expert advice and troubleshooting guidance for medical staff.

Laparoscopy Insufflator Repair Service Cost In Gabon

Laparoscopy insufflator repair services in Gabon can vary in cost due to several factors. These include the complexity of the repair, the specific brand and model of the insufflator, the availability of spare parts, and the technician's experience and reputation. Labor rates for medical equipment repair can also fluctuate depending on the location within Gabon (e.g., Libreville versus smaller towns) and the urgency of the repair. Many medical facilities may have service contracts with third-party repair providers, which can influence pricing. For critical equipment like laparoscopy insufflators, the downtime cost can also indirectly affect the perceived value of a repair, pushing facilities towards faster, albeit potentially more expensive, solutions. The use of original versus aftermarket parts can also impact the final price. Unfortunately, precise average costs are difficult to pinpoint without direct quotes from service providers in Gabon, as this information is not widely published. However, based on general trends in medical equipment repair in developing economies, one can expect a range of pricing, particularly when considering the exchange rate fluctuations of the CFA franc.

Cost ComponentPotential Range (XAF - Central African CFA Franc)
Diagnostic Fee20,000 - 50,000
Minor Repairs (e.g., sensor replacement, calibration)50,000 - 150,000
Moderate Repairs (e.g., pump repair, circuit board issues)150,000 - 400,000
Major Repairs (e.g., significant component replacement, complex system failures)400,000 - 1,000,000+
Cost of Spare PartsHighly variable, can be a significant portion of the total cost.
Labor (per hour/day)30,000 - 75,000+

Scope Of Work For Laparoscopy Insufflator Repair Service

This Scope of Work (SOW) outlines the requirements for the repair service of a laparoscopy insufflator. The objective is to restore the insufflator to full operational functionality, ensuring accuracy, safety, and reliability in accordance with established medical device standards and manufacturer specifications. This document details the technical deliverables, standard specifications, and acceptance criteria for the repair process.

ParameterStandard SpecificationAcceptance Criteria
Gas Flow Rate Accuracy± 5% of set flow rate (e.g., 1-30 L/min) as per manufacturer specifications and IEC 60601-1 standards.Measured flow rate falls within ± 5% of the set value across the operational range during functional testing.
Intra-abdominal Pressure Accuracy± 2 mmHg of set pressure (e.g., 0-30 mmHg) as per manufacturer specifications and relevant medical device standards.Measured intra-abdominal pressure is within ± 2 mmHg of the set value during functional testing.
Pressure StabilityPressure fluctuation not exceeding ± 1 mmHg during stable insufflation.Observed pressure fluctuations remain within ± 1 mmHg for a continuous 5-minute period at a stable set pressure.
Leakage RateNegligible leakage, not affecting the ability to maintain set pressure.Insufflator successfully maintains set pressure with a simulated leak rate of < 0.5 L/min (or manufacturer-defined specification).
Alarm System FunctionalityAll audible and visual alarms (e.g., high pressure, low pressure, gas supply failure, system malfunction) activate correctly and promptly.All programmed alarm conditions are triggered and function as designed during fault injection testing.
Component Lifespan/ReliabilityRepaired or replaced components meet or exceed their expected operational lifespan and reliability as defined by the manufacturer.No premature failure of repaired/replaced components within a specified warranty period (e.g., 90 days).
Electrical SafetyCompliance with IEC 60601-1 for electrical safety, including dielectric strength, leakage current, and grounding.Passes all electrical safety tests as per IEC 60601-1 during post-repair testing.
Hygienic StandardsUnit is cleaned and disinfected to appropriate medical device hygiene standards, free from visible contamination.Visual inspection confirms cleanliness and disinfection. Manufacturer's recommended cleaning agents are used.

Technical Deliverables

  • Comprehensive diagnostic report detailing the identified faults, root cause analysis, and proposed repair strategy.
  • Replacement or repair of faulty components (e.g., pressure regulator, flow meter, pump, electronic control board, valves, sensors).
  • Calibration of gas flow rate and intra-abdominal pressure to manufacturer specifications.
  • Functional testing of all insufflator modes and safety features (e.g., over-pressure relief, leak detection).
  • Cleaning and disinfection of the insufflator unit and accessories (if applicable).
  • Updated operational manual or service record reflecting the repair and calibration performed.
  • Certification of successful repair and calibration, including test results.
